Where to Go
There are many things to see and do in Kalamata, including:
- Visit the Kalamata Castle: The castle is a popular tourist attraction and offers stunning views of the city.
- Explore the Old Town: The Old Town is a charming area with narrow streets, traditional houses, and many shops and restaurants.
- Relax on the beach: Kalamata has several beaches where you can relax and enjoy the sun and sand.
- Visit the Archaeological Museum of Kalamata: The museum houses a collection of artifacts from the region's history.
- Take a day trip to Mystras: Mystras is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and is home to several Byzantine churches and monasteries.
